https://issues.dlang.org/show_bug.cgi?id=19379 Issue ID: 19379 Summary: Make a public alias for the return type of std.typecons.scoped Product: D Version: D2 Hardware: x86_64 OS: Linux Status: NEW Severity: enhancement Priority: P1 Component: phobos Assignee: nobody puremagic.com Reporter: dhasenan gmail.com The documentation for std.typecons.scoped says to use typeof() to identify the type. I know the arguments for keeping the actual type opaque. We've been over it with std.regex.Captures and so forth. It would be really great to have a way to name that type succinctly so you can use it in fields, pass it as a parameter (by reference obviously), instantiate templates of it, explicitly name variable types, that kind of thing, without having to use aliases everywhere.
